Abstract
Ribonucleoprotein (RNP) complexes can form multiple mesoscale assemblies, including stress granules (SGs). However, the function and regulation of the soluble RNP complexes are not fully understood. A recent study by Boraas et al. showed that G3BP1, a key node in SG formation, forms focal adhesion (FA)-localized RNP complexes and regulates cell migration.
